Cartilage: Volume 1: Physiology and Development
This volume illustrates the complex processes of chondrogenesis and cartilage maintenanceInsights into biomechanics and function of cartilageTogether the three Volumes provide a comprehensive overview on cartilage biology, pathophysiology and regeneration strategiesIn three Volumes this mini book series presents current knowledge and new perspectives on cartilage as a specialized yet versatile tissue. This first volume provides a comprehensive overview on the basic biology of cartilage development followed by a description of cartilage structure and biomechanics.
